Provision of Radio-Based Explosive Ordnance Risk Education (EORE) Services in BAY States, Nigeria
Summary
Description
Agency: UNOPS | Reference: RFQ/2026/62586 | Type: Request for quotation
Tender description: Provision of Radio-Based Explosive Ordinance Risk Education (EORE) Services in Bay States, Nigeria-----IMPORTANT NOTE: Interested vendorsmust respond to this tender using the UNOPS eSourcing system, via the UNGM portal.
In order to access the full UNOPS tender details, request clarifications on the tender, and submit a vendor response to a tender using the system, vendors need to be registered as a UNOPS vendor at the UNGM portal and be logged into UNGM.

About This Opportunity
This is a supplies contract in the media and communication and education and training sectors. Located in Nigeria, Africa, this opportunity is open to firms and consortiums. Proposals must be submitted before May 7, 2026.
